I've only used the Kylon fusion plastic paint once. Tried black on my white (yellowing) refrigerator handles. Lasted about a month until I couldn't stand looking at all the white showing through the scratches. I was temped to try it on my white KLX plastics, but I'm not impressed with the claimed durability.
